| Beschrijving voorzijde | Right-facing effigy of Queen Elizabeth II, wearing the Girls of Great Britain and Ireland tiara, as engraved by Ian Rank-Broadley, whose initials IRB appear below the truncation. The legend ELIZABETH II is inscribed along the left periphery and NIUE along the upper border, with TWO DOLLARS along the right periphery. The date 2022 appears in the lower field. The portrait is set against a smooth, unadorned field within a plain raised rim. |

Niue has operated as a licensing vehicle for foreign coin programs since the 1990s, with the New Zealand dependency lending its name and legal tender status to collectibles produced almost entirely for the international bullion and novelty market. This piece is part of a Disney licensing arrangement — Bambi was first released by Walt Disney Productions in 1942, adapted from Felix Salten's 1923 Austrian novel. The film was a commercial disappointment on its original release, recovering its costs only after a 1947 re-release.
